It seems well designed, it seems to have better insulation than most countertop air fryers which is to say none at all on most whereas this one seems to take a while to get hot on the outside which implies that there is some kind of insulation in there which is good I appreciate efficiency. It's a good size, the screen could be a little better it's really hard to read unless you are looking at it at a very specific angle. So far the coating is holding up on the nonstick inside I do cook a lot of bacon in mine so it tends to have to deal with a lot of oil and at least so far it's not baking on super hard I'm able to wipe it down with just a damp cloth. I like the magnet to pull out the tray when it's in the air fryer mode that's helpful I do wish the magnet went up and down the whole thing so that it could help pull it out just a little bit regardless of its position but I understand why they put it there only. I do like that some of the extra features like Frozen actually do something different it does actually change the way the heating elements put out the Heat to avoid burning the outside while the the'si nice the most crumb tray has enough clearance that I can put a layer of tinfoil on it without it jamming. Not a feature most manufacturers probably think about but I appreciate it because it's how I keep the crumb tray nicer I just put some tin foil on it and when that gets too dirty I can just replace it.
The most important feature that I am very happy about is the preheat. So many air fryers are trying to do that 60 second or less preheat bs and it's just a lie. It is literally not possible on a 15A outlet to get to 300-400° in that short of time. So thank you for actually doing a real preheat cycle that actually gets up to temp
